Przegląd API
API ConsentForge to REST API z treściami żądań i odpowiedzi w formacie JSON.
Podstawowy URL
https://api.consentforge.com/api/v1/
Wersjonowanie
API jest wersjonowane przez ścieżkę URL. Bieżąca wersja to v1. Zmiany powodujące niezgodność będą wydawane pod nową wersją z odpowiednim wyprzedzeniem.
Format
- Wszystkie żądania i odpowiedzi używają JSON (
Content-Type: application/json) - Wszystkie ciągi znaków są w UTF-8
- Znaczniki czasu są w formacie ISO 8601 w UTC (np.
2026-03-09T12:00:00Z) - Identyfikatory są w formacie UUID
Uwierzytelnianie
Dwa typy tokenów:
- Token API — do operacji zarządzania (wyłącznie Twój backend, nigdy nie udostępniaj w przeglądarkach)
- Token osadzenia — do operacji środowiska uruchomieniowego (bezpieczny do publicznego użycia w tagach
<script>)
Szczegóły znajdziesz w Uwierzytelnianie.